[AJUDA] equipar com "F"
#1

tipw como o titulo ja diz queria uma ajuda pra quando o player apertase "f" ou "enter" onde equipa ele equipase ou abrise 1 menu em dialog pra equipar etc.. eu nao estou falando ki quero ki vcs faz e sim ke me ensinen se tiver como agradeзo (:
Reply
#2

https://sampwiki.blast.hk/wiki/GetPlayerKeys#Key_List



Att.: Button.
Reply
#3

entao 6.6.6 eu ja vi isso eu entendi +- nao entendi direito como faser
tiver como me da 1 exemplo ;s
Reply
#4

pawn Код:
if(newkeys == 16) // 16 й o nъmero da tecla
{
     if(!IsPlayerInRangeOfPoint(playerid, 5.0, pX, pY, pZ))
     {
          SendClientMessage(playerid, 0xC96969FF, "Vocк tem que estar no local para equipar"); // vai verificar se ele tб na cordenada se nгo tiver retorna a mensagem
     }
     GivePlayerWeapon(playerid, 24, 200); // vai setar a arma a ele
     SendClientMessage(playerid, 0xE31919FF, "[~] {FFFFF}Vocк recebeu uma Eagle!"); // vai enviar a msg a ele.
}
Este cуdigo tem que estar na public OnPlayerKeyStateChange.
Reply
#5

muito obrigado 6.6.6 repu (:
Reply
#6

nada ^^ precisar estamos ai. hehe
Reply
#7

cara tah dand oseguinte erro
pawn Код:
C:\Users\Marli\Downloads\Iniciante\gamemodes\Iniciante.pwn(207) : error 010: invalid function or declaration
C:\Users\Marli\Downloads\Iniciante\gamemodes\Iniciante.pwn(209) : error 029: invalid expression, assumed zero
C:\Users\Marli\Downloads\Iniciante\gamemodes\Iniciante.pwn(209) : error 029: invalid expression, assumed zero
C:\Users\Marli\Downloads\Iniciante\gamemodes\Iniciante.pwn(211) : error 010: invalid function or declaration
Pawn compiler 3.2.3664          Copyright (c) 1997-2006, ITB CompuPhase


4 Errors.

linha do erro :;
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
if ((newkeys == 16))
}
if(!IsPlayerInRangeOfPoint(playerid, 5.0, 1152.4468,-1186.6064,32.0275))
Reply
#8

pawn Код:
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
    if(newkeys == 16) // 16 й o nъmero da tecla
    {
         if(!IsPlayerInRangeOfPoint(playerid, 5.0, pX, pY, pZ))
         {
              SendClientMessage(playerid, 0xC96969FF, "Vocк tem que estar no local para equipar"); // vai verificar se ele tб na cordenada se nгo tiver retorna a mensagem
         }
         GivePlayerWeapon(playerid, 24, 200); // vai setar a arma a ele
         SendClientMessage(playerid, 0xE31919FF, "[~] {FFFFF}Vocк recebeu uma Eagle!"); // vai enviar a msg a ele.
     }
     return 1;
}
Reply
#9

erro continua nessas 2 linha
public OnPlayerKeyStateChange(playerid, newkeys, oldkeys)
{
if(newkeys == 16) // 16 й o nъmero da tecla
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)